The air in the factory was thick with the smell of sweat and metal, a suffocating blanket that clung to Lavinia’s lungs. Her fingers, raw and aching, moved with practiced monotony, assembling delicate components under the flickering, weak light. Around her, the rhythmic clang of machinery was a constant, grating symphony of human labor.

Then, the rhythm fractured. A sudden hush, thick with apprehension, fell over the workroom. Lavinia didn't need to look up to know why. A shadow had fallen across the grimy floor, one that promised not relief, but a different kind of pain.

She kept her head down, but her senses sharpened. The subtle shift in the air, the collective tightening of muscles around her, spoke volumes. He was here.
